14. to use the shortest cable path possible The order in which fixtures are connected in a DMX line does not influence the DMX addressing For example a fixture assigned a DMX address of 1 may be placed anywhere in a DMX line at the beginning at the end or anywhere in the middle When a fixture is assigned a DMX address of 1 the DMX controller knows to send DATA assigned to address 1 to that unit no matter where it is located in the DMX chain Data Cable DMX Cable Requirements For DMX Operation The COB Cannon Wash can be controlled via DMX 512 protocol The COB Cannon Wash has 7 DMX modes please see pages 9 10 for the different modes The DMX address is set on the back panel of the COB Cannon Wash Your unit and your DMX controller require a stan dard 3 pin XLR connector for data input and data output Figure 1 We recommend Accu Cable DMX cables If you are making your own cables be sure to use standard 110 120 Ohm shielded cable This cable may be purchased at almost all pro lighting stores Your cables should be made with a male and female XLR connector on either end of the cable Also remember that DMX cable must be daisy chained and cannot be split Figure 1 ADJ Products LLC www adj com COB Cannon Wash User Manual Page 5 Cannon Wash DMX Set Up Notice Be sure to follow figures two and three when making your own cables Do not use the ground lug on the XLR connector Do not con nect the cable s s

21. hield conductor to the ground lug or allow the shield conductor to come in contact with the XLR s outer casing Grounding the shield could cause a short circuit and erratic behavior COMMON DMX512 OUT DMX512 IN 3 PIN XLR DMX 3 PIN XLR we mm mm XLR Male Socket XLR Female Socket 1 Ground 2 Cold Figure 3 Special Note Line Termination When longer runs of cable are used you may need to use a terminator on the last unit to avoid erratic behavior A terminator is a 110 120 ohm 1 4 watt resistor which is con nected between pins 2 and 3 of a male XLR connector DATA and DATA This unit is inserted in the female XLR connector of the last unit in your daisy chain to terminate the line Using a cable terminator ADJ part number Z DMX T will decrease the possibilities of erratic behavior Termination reduces signal errors and avoids signal transmission problems 5 interference lt is always advisable D 5 to connect a DMX terminal Resistance 120 Ohm 1 4 W between PIN 2 DMX and PIN 3 DMX of the last fixture Figure 4 Figure 2 XLR Pin Configuration 1 1 2 Cold 1 Ground 1 Pin 1 Ground 1 Pin 2 Data Compliment negative 1 1 1 Pin Data True positive 5 Pin XLR DMX Connectors Some manufactures use 5 pin DMX 512 data cables for DATA transmission in place of 3 pin 5 pin DMX fixtures may be implemented in a 3 pin DMX line When inserting stan dard
